闫宝龙

随着互联网的普及,网络安全问题日益凸显。SSL证书作为一种保障网络安全的重要手段,被广泛应用于各种网络应用中。在实际应用过程中,我们经常会遇到无法验证SSL证书的情况。本文将围绕无法验证SSL证书这一主题,从原因、影响和解决方法等方面进行探讨。
一、无法验证SSL证书的原因
1. 证书过期
SSL证书具有一定的有效期,一旦过期,客户端就无法验证证书的有效性。证书过期可能是由于管理员忘记续费,或者证书颁发机构未能及时更新证书信息所致。
2. 证书颁发机构问题
证书颁发机构(CA)是负责颁发和管理SSL证书的机构。如果证书颁发机构存在信任问题,或者其证书被列入黑名单,客户端将无法验证证书的有效性。
3. 证书链不完整
SSL证书通常由多个证书组成,形成一个证书链。如果证书链中的某个证书缺失或损坏,客户端将无法验证证书的有效性。
4. 证书格式不正确
SSL证书的格式可能存在错误,如编码错误、格式错误等。这些错误可能导致客户端无法正确解析证书信息,从而无法验证证书的有效性。
5. 证书被篡改

恶意攻击者可能会对SSL证书进行篡改,使其失效。这种情况下,客户端将无法验证证书的有效性。
二、无法验证SSL证书的影响
1. 网络安全风险
无法验证SSL证书意味着无法确保数据传输的安全性。这可能导致敏感信息泄露,给用户带来安全隐患。
2. 用户体验下降
当用户遇到无法验证SSL证书的情况时,可能会对网站或应用产生信任危机,从而影响用户体验。
3. 业务损失
对于一些依赖网络应用的企业来说,无法验证SSL证书可能导致业务中断,从而造成经济损失。
三、解决无法验证SSL证书的方法
1. 及时更新证书
管理员应定期检查SSL证书的有效期,确保证书在有效期内。一旦证书过期,应及时续费或重新申请。
2. 选择可靠的证书颁发机构
选择信誉良好的证书颁发机构,确保证书的安全性。关注证书颁发机构的信任问题,避免使用被列入黑名单的证书。
3. 检查证书链完整性
确保证书链中的所有证书都完整且未被篡改。如果发现证书链不完整,应及时修复。
4. 检查证书格式
确保证书格式正确,避免因格式错误导致无法验证证书。
5. 定期检查证书安全性
定期检查证书的安全性,防止证书被篡改。一旦发现证书被篡改,应及时更换。
四、总结
无法验证SSL证书是网络安全中常见的问题。了解其原因、影响和解决方法,有助于我们更好地保障网络安全。在实际应用中,管理员应关注SSL证书的更新、选择可靠的证书颁发机构、检查证书链完整性、确保证书格式正确,以及定期检查证书安全性,从而降低网络安全风险,提升用户体验。
来源:闫宝龙博客(微信/QQ号:18097696),有任何问题请及时联系!
版权声明1,本站转载作品(包括论坛内容)出于传递更多信息之目的,不承担任何法律责任,如有侵权请联系管理员删除。2,本站原创作品转载须注明“稿件来源”否则禁止转载!